These statements explain why -&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;Facts you should know about the early census records –&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;All census records [1790 – 1840] prior to the 1850 census ONLY listed the head of household; whether male or female. &l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;NO specific age was stated for any family member&lt;br&gt;NO place of birth was stated – city, state, or country &lt;br&gt;NO city, town, or village is stated – only the county; however some census takers listed the township&lt;br&gt;NO street address was stated&lt;br&gt;NO marital status was stated – single, married, widowed, or divorced&lt;br&gt;NO family relationship was stated – brother, sister, cousin, son, daughter, wife, inlaw, etc…&lt;br&gt;NO occupation was stated&lt;br&gt;NO parental birthplaces are stated			&lt;br&gt;NO race was stated [but assume “white”] &lt;br&gt;	&lt;br&gt;1850, 1860 &amp;amp; 1870 census records do not show family relationships, marital status or parental birthplaces.&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;Step children are not enumerated as “step” children&lt;br&gt;Adopted children are not enumerated as “adopted”&lt;br&gt;Grand children are not enumerated as “grand children”&lt;br&gt;Orphaned children were not enumerated as "orphan"&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;1850 is the 1st census that shows all family members &l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;1880 is the 1st census that shows parental birthplaces and family relationships +++&lt;br&gt;</description>

      <description>Transcribed from Herald &amp;amp; Review 29 June 2000&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;John Earl Probst 79, Ramsey, formerly of Bingham and Fillmore, retired farmer, died Tuesday (June 27, 2000). Member: Canaan Chapel Church of God, Bingham, Fayette Co. Farm Bureau. Survivors: wife, Evelyn; son, Gary, Bellingham, Wash.; daughters, Connie Weller, Bethalto; Gail Greer, Trenton; brothers, Denver, Fillmore; Paul, Bingham; eight grandchildren; four stepgrandchildren; two great-grandchildren; seven great-stepgrandchildren. Preceded by parents.&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;Services: 11 a.m. Friday, Miller Funeral Home, Fillmore. Visitation: 6 to 8 p.m. Thursday. Burial: Glendale Cemetery, Fillmore. Memorials: Church of God Building Fund, Vandalia.&lt;br&gt;</description>

Since I haven't seen anything on him here in the message boards in a while, I thought that I would retouch on the subject.&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;John "Uncle Jackie" Berry was born August 20, 1794 in Port William, Kentucky. He lived to be 103 years old, and fathered 21 children by two wives. He first married Elizabeth Melton, who was born October 18, 1806 in Rutherford Co., North Carolina. They married October 27, 1826 in Fayette Co., Illinois. Their first child was William Kendall Berry born 1828 in Fayette Co., Illinois.&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;After that, they moved to Missouri, living a short time in Phelps and Crawford Co., Missouri before eventually settling in Dent Co., Missouri.&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;The rest of the children by Elizabeth were,&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;John Henry&lt;br&gt;Martin Henry&lt;br&gt;James Hamilton&lt;br&gt;Rebecca Elizabeth&lt;br&gt;Amos Ery&lt;br&gt;Francis Marion&lt;br&gt;Cynthia Anne&lt;br&gt;Silas Asa&lt;br&gt;Loucasta Rebecca&lt;br&gt;David Arcadia&lt;br&gt;Elizabeth&lt;br&gt;Jemima Angeline&lt;br&gt;Enoch Ebenezer&lt;br&gt;Jackie Jr.&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;Elizabeth Melton died August 29, 1865 in Dent Co., Missouri. After which, John married a widow Rebecca Lucinda Creasey York, born January 21, 1823 in Tennessee.&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;They had an additional six children, who were,&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;Martha Jane&lt;br&gt;Joseph George Washington&lt;br&gt;Mary Ellen&lt;br&gt;Calvin Theodore&lt;br&gt;Andrew Jackson&lt;br&gt;Pacific&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;John "Uncle Jacke" Berry died January 7, 1898 in Salem, Dent Co., Missouri at the age of 103.&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;From what I understand, no one has found out who his parents were. There is some speculation that his father was also born in Kentucky in 1769 and his mother's name is Rebecca born 1774 in Germany. But I am not so sure that that information is even correct.&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;I suspect that John and Elizabeth gave their first born William a surname as a middle name "Kendall".
